Hello,
We are considering setting up SandBlast Threat Emulation/Extraction for a client with the emulation of the files in CheckPoint cloud, however there is a concern about the confidentiality and privacy of the sent files.
I could not find any document or SK describing the privacy policy and how long the files are kept on CheckPoint servers, what information is kept, etc.
Did I miss something or should I open a case to get this information?
Thanks
See the following: Check Point Cloud Service Security Statement and GDPR Data Information
It's possible a more current version of this can be obtained from your account team.
